with me all my alters were different than me some had problems I had and some had problems I did not have. but because it was one whole body that everyone lived with in, the best way to handle health problems and mental health problems was to treat me the body person. this way treatments would not counteract each other leading to a dangerous possibly life threatening situation.

in other words to address the eating disorder of me and those alters with eating disorders I the body person (or in your words the host) entered an eating disorder treatment program, this taught me and those that took control because of eating issues what was healthy for us, and how to follow treatment provider approved diet plans rather than starving/ purging and other eating disorder ways.

one thing about my system... it was dissociative related meaning I was diagnosed with DID because my alters would take control when ever I the body person had my dissociative symptoms due to triggers (Triggers can be good or bad, they are anything that caused me to feel any strong emotions, even things like feeling frustrated because I did not know how to do something so an alter took control to do that for me)

anytime I felt my dissociation symptoms an alter took control to handle that. one time I asked my therapist how did the alters know when to take control and who to take control. she said that with me there was a sort of filter which was my dissociation symptoms and the alters sense of agency (their job, purpose, reason for being created, how much control they had and more)

based on this filtering system what worked for me would "filter down" to the right alters. so my treatments also helped the alters with the same problems that I was having with eating disorders.

maybe you can talk with your treatment providers, they can help you to find treatments that will help both you and the alters that have eating disorders like mine did.
